Q. Is doubles still good a way of taking the pressure off yourself or do you think of it very much as matches like singles matches?
MARTINA HINGIS: Both ways it's good. I mean, playing with Mary, it's a lot of fun, entertaining. It was good.Obviously it was a long day and everything, but I felt very good. You get the volleys, practice, everything, just try to be aggressive. You get the court sense also very well. In doubles especially you have to place it well, just try to do things.Plus I haven't played that many matches on clay yet, so every match for me is going to be good. Hopefully it's going to get better and better, as it did already today from yesterday. I think it was a big improvement.
